Output e40511369c65ada73af510a5974b5c54f916e603cf644586186dee05d90411a1:1

value
1021392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8dd6e5419fc686b5dee8e12d9188337acd49d43 OP_EQUAL
address
3NvHxLngo5YFv4YXux9pAgxqXs3tj5u7rW
transaction
e40511369c65ada73af510a5974b5c54f916e603cf644586186dee05d90411a1
confirmations
333299
spent
true